The Ikejime method involves swiftly and expertly severing the fish's spinal cord, minimizing stress and preserving the quality of the flesh. This humane approach not only enhances the flavour and texture of the fish but also aligns with Dundrun's dedication to responsible fishing practices.
Rooted in Japanese culture, this meticulous technique involves the humane and precise harvesting of fish, ensuring the highest quality of seafood for discerning palates.
The Ikejime method, seamlessly integrated into the fisherman's routines, reflects a harmonious blend of traditional Japanese wisdom and Norwegian expertise, resulting in a seafood experience that is both ethically and gastronomically satisfying.
